工作中经常会用到的把几个Excel文件合并到一个,或者是把一个Excel文件里的所有Sheet合并到一个Sheet来进行统计。下面分别提供用vba宏来解决这两个问题的方法。1、合并Excel文件打开一个空Excel文件,Alt+F11,插入一个模块,开始写代码:Sub MergeWorkbooks()    Dim FileSet    Dim i As I
转载 精选 2014-05-16 13:51:34
7584阅读
合并多个EXCEL代码 今天工作时,写一个文档,突然需要将多个excel工作簿合并成一个,于是总结一下,希望有用。 1、合并多个EXCEL为同一个EXCEL Sub CombineWorkbooks() Dim FilesToOpen Dim x As Integer On Error GoTo ErrHandler Application.ScreenUpd
转载 精选 2014-03-02 18:24:50
10000+阅读
1点赞
1评论
目录Excel VBA函数定义合并所有工作簿REFRENCESExcel VBA函数定义合并所有工作簿直接合并Sub 合并当前目录下所有工作簿的全部工作()Dim MyPath, MyName, AWbNameDim Wb As Workbook, WbN As StringDim G As LongDim Num As LongDim BOX As String...
原创 2022-02-10 17:01:00
2183阅读
目录Excel VBA函数定义合并所有工作簿REFRENCESExcel VBA函数定义合并所有工作簿直接合并Sub 合并当前目录下所有工作簿的全部工作()Dim MyPath, MyName, AWbNameDim Wb As Workbook, WbN As StringDim G As LongDim Num As LongDim BOX As String...
原创 2021-06-09 20:32:09
1563阅读
Sub UnionWorksheets()       Dim i  As Long            循环变量    i = 0        Dim j  As Long            循环变量    j = 0    Dim insert_row As Long    合并文件中的粘贴位置    Application.ScreenUpdating = Fal
原创 2022-12-13 11:47:33
756阅读
职场办公高效必备就是Excel表格了,用过的人都说好,但是你们知道怎样合并多个Excel工作吗,想必大多数人还在贴贴复制,重复使用贴贴复制太耗时,容易出现错误,多个工作合并为一个工作簿其实很简单,下面分享三个经验所得,30秒实现表格合并,你们可选择使用任意一个方法哦。 方法一打开Excel新建一张汇总表,点击工具栏【数据】选择【新建查询】—【从文件夹】在弹出的文本框选择文件路径(所
适用范围:Microsoft Office Excel 2003寻找能够为 Excel 工作增加额外功能的宏。只需稍加练习,您就可以扩展这些程序,使其适合您自己的应用程序。本页内容引言 引言导出带有逗号和引号分隔符的文本文件 导出带有逗号和引号分隔符的文本文件计算包含公式、文本或数字的单元格数量 计算包含公式、文本或数字的单元格数量使用 Saved 属性确定工作簿是否已发生更改 使...
转载 2009-10-29 10:28:00
513阅读
2评论
Fromhttp://www.zhihu.com/question/20366713VBA代码如下: 1 Sub 工作薄间工作合并() 2 3 Dim FileOpen 4 Dim X As Integer 5 Application.ScreenUpdating = False 6 FileO...
转载 2014-05-09 07:36:00
2127阅读
2评论
#!/usr/bin/env python import xlsxwriter,xlrd import sys,os.path reload(sys)  sys.setdefaultencoding('utf8') def MergeExcelToWorksheet(*arg): lfile=arg fname={} worksheet={
原创 2015-09-10 11:06:55
716阅读
按Alt+F11两键,调出Visual Basic 界面,在左侧窗口中,右键选择“插入”—“模块”,将代码粘贴进去,点击运行按钮,完成数据合并。Sub 合并当前工作簿下的所有工作() On Error Resume Next Application.ScreenUpdating = False Application.DisplayAlerts = False Set st = Workshe
原创 2023-04-20 23:01:07
539阅读
工作保护密码忘记了,怎么解除
原创 2023-08-17 17:09:57
8538阅读
1点赞
1评论
                  今天和大家分享的是隐藏工作的方法。普通情况下,也是大家所熟知的方法,就是右键点击所要隐藏的工作然后选择hide。操作如下再找sheet2就不见了。如果再显示呢,右键点击工作标签,
原创 精选 2015-06-29 15:17:24
5335阅读
2点赞
1评论
话说,最近几次我们都更新了与excel相关的功能,那今天我就再来更新一篇处理excel的文章,那我们就来看看具体的功能!
原创 精选 10月前
265阅读
Option Compare Database '按批次分配 Private Sub Command0_Click() 'ADO连接数据库 Dim rs As ADODB.Recordset Set rs = New ADODB.Recordset Dim strSQL As String Dim name As String, pass As Strin
需求: 根据列合并; 同一列中相邻内容一致的合并成一个单元格, 以变美观   分析: 在需要合并的sheet中, 加入一个按钮, 点击此按钮 出现提示框, 让用户自己输入需要合并的列; 列名可以为数字或字母; 如输入1, 代表第一列; 输入A, 也代表第一列 自动判断所有的行数; 进行循环遍历; 将此列内容相同的相邻2列或几列, 合并单元格 难点: 合并单元格总出现提示
原创 2011-11-16 14:40:26
3108阅读
2点赞
1评论
在上篇博客https://blog.csdn.net/whandgdh/article/details/100184090,讲到了把一个工作拆分为多个,那其实也可以把多个工作合并为一个。继续之前的例子,我们把汇总表删除如下把 1,2,3 合并到sheet5中合并代码如下:Sub 合并当前工作簿下的所有工作()Applicat
原创 2023-05-24 10:22:44
1639阅读
工作中,经常会用到将一个EXCEL文件中的多个SHEET内容合并到一个SHEET中,为了提高效率,节省时间,想用VBA一键实现,下面是代码部分:
原创 2022-05-26 19:48:37
5292阅读
1评论
Python_pandas实现excel工作合并功能
原创 2019-08-28 16:52:27
5335阅读
1点赞
同一文件夹内N个工作簿 ,每个工作簿里N个工作,最终合并到一个工作表里的代码。 假设每个表格结构相同,第一行为标题,第二行为头,表头内容固定,行数不固定,列固定14,工作数量不固定,工作簿数量不固定。 Sub Sample() Dim MyWb As Workbook Dim MySht As
sed
原创 2022-09-20 06:16:42
355阅读
 将工作簿中的工作制成目录汇总在“目录”A1开始的单元格中 Sub mulu()      Dim mysheet As Worksheet      Dim i As 
原创 2011-11-13 22:25:26
2133阅读
  • 1
  • 2
  • 3
  • 4
  • 5